- Built to replace the legendary WWII Jeep, this four-wheeled behemoth would play a vital role when traversing the sands of the Middle East during the Persian Gulf War.
Four three decades, it would remain a symbol of American brawn, playing a major role in every conflict ever since it rolled off the assembly line, towing soldiers, missiles, machine guns, satellite communication dishes, or whatever else was needed-a true “do-anything” vehicle for a constantly evolving battlefield.
